Why are the democratic bills that are passed generally a half measure?

Why did the ACA only address part of the issue and not provide a single payer option?

It's because as soon as a democrat in any form pitches legislation that could actually improve the life of every day people, every single republican votes against it.

If even one republican votes to end the filibuster on the ACA, the Democrats dont have to take out the single payer option to appease Independent Joel Lieberman.

The build back better bill only passed after Republicans shred it, taking out extended family leave, shortening the child tax credit, removing 2 years of free community college, removing the addition of dental and vision to Medicaid, among other climate and green energy incentives and tax credits.

Do not get me wrong. The democrats are not great and could be doing much more to better the lives of average Americans. But they are also chained to a boulder which is the entire republican party.

When playing D, best way to keep O out of the net? by CinemaPuck in hockeyplayers

[–]Spade18 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Pushing strategy works. But if you are looking for alternatives, hear me out here, use your butt. Your butt is the most important part of your body in hockey. You already said you’re smaller than most people you play against, so you have the advantage of a lower center of gravity. If you want to get people out of the way, plant your butt anywhere between their hip and the knee and pretty much t push backward. It lets you keep your position facing the puck, keeps your stick available to tie up their stick if the puck comes your way, and because of your center of gravity it will push people off balance or out of the way.
